Scheduler for WPF | ComponentOne
C1.WPF.Schedule Namespace / C1Scheduler Class / UserDeletingAppointment Event

In This Topic
    UserDeletingAppointment Event (C1Scheduler)
    In This Topic
    Occurs before the currently selected C1.C1Schedule.Appointment is deleted by a user or as a result of the DeleteAppointment method call or receiving the C1Scheduler.DeleteAppointmentCommand command.
    Syntax
    'Declaration
     
    
    Public Event UserDeletingAppointment As EventHandler(Of AppointmentActionEventArgs)
    public event EventHandler<AppointmentActionEventArgs> UserDeletingAppointment
    Event Data

    The event handler receives an argument of type AppointmentActionEventArgs containing data related to this event. The following AppointmentActionEventArgs properties provide information specific to this event.

    PropertyDescription
    Gets an Appointment object.  
    (Inherited from System.Windows.RoutedEventArgs)
    (Inherited from System.Windows.RoutedEventArgs)
    (Inherited from System.Windows.RoutedEventArgs)
    (Inherited from System.Windows.RoutedEventArgs)
    Remarks
    Use this event to make custom actions before appointment deletion and/or to implement your own reaction on this event. To prevent a deletion of the appointment, set the e.Handled event argument to True.
    See Also